Globally Optimal FIR Filters with Applications in Source and Channel Coding - Information Theory, 1998. Proceedings. 1998 IEEE International Symposium on

In this paper, we derive a novel formulation to solve an important FIlR filter optimization problem. The problem has received considerable at tention in the past because it appears in a wide variety of disciplines. The newliy proposed method finds the globally optimal solution to the problem and provides several other advantages over previous optimization techniques. I . متن کاملOptimal Sequential Vector Quantization of Markov Sources - Information Theory, 1998. Proceedings. 1998 IEEE International Symposium on
The problem of optimal sequential vector quantization of Markov sources is cast as a stochastic control problem wi th partial observations and constraints, leading to useful existence results for optimal codes and their characterizations.
متن کاملRobust Decoding for Non-Gaussian CDMA and Non-Exponential Timing Channels - Information Theory, 1998. Proceedings. 1998 IEEE International Symposium on
The capacity region of the two-user Gaussian CDMA channel is shown to be achievable when the (stationary, ergodic) noise is not Gaussian, using a decoder matched to the Gaussian distribution. Similarly, the capacity of the exponential server timing channel is shown to be achievable when the service distribution is not exponential, using a decoder matched to the exponential distribution.
